Course Overview This internationally accredited postgraduate program equips graduates to become competent managers and practitioners in the dynamic field of Occupational and Environmental Health & Safety (OEHS). The curriculum provides a multidisciplinary foundation in workplace safety, exposure assessment, and sustainability, preparing you for senior roles within industry, regulatory agencies, or consultancies. Your studies will be enhanced by the opportunity to complete a research thesis, potentially in collaboration with your current employer. Key Program Highlights Earn a qualification with dual international accreditation from IOSH (UK) and the British Occupational Hygiene Society (BOHS). Meet the academic requirements for Graduate membership with IOSH, the direct pathway to becoming a Chartered safety practitioner. Gain eligibility for Associate Membership of the BOHS Faculty of Occupational Hygiene, with exemptions for higher-level credentials. Complete a practical research thesis that can be undertaken at your place of work or with university researchers. Prepare for managerial responsibilities with a curriculum recognized by the Health and Safety Authority.
